About this route:

A direct, nonstop flight between Kigali International Airport (KGL), Kigali, Rwanda and Bourg - Ceyzériat Airport (XBK), Bourg-en-Bresse, France would travel a Great Circle distance of 3,657 miles (or 5,885 kilometers).

A Great Circle is the shortest distance between 2 points on a sphere. Because most world maps are flat (but the Earth is round), the route of the shortest distance between 2 points on the Earth will often appear curved when viewed on a flat map, especially for long distances. If you were to simply draw a straight line on a flat map and measure a very long distance, it would likely be much further than if you were to lay a string between those two points on a globe. Because of the large distance between Kigali International Airport and Bourg - Ceyzériat Airport, the route shown on this map most likely appears curved because of this reason.

Facts about Kigali International Airport (KGL):

  • The furthest airport from Kigali International Airport (KGL) is Cassidy International Airport (CXI), which is located 11,920 miles (19,183 kilometers) away in Christmas Island, Kiribati.
  • Rwandair has its head office on the top floor of the airport's main building.
  • Kigali International Airport (KGL) currently has only 1 runway.
  • Because of Kigali International Airport's high elevation of 4,891 feet, planes must typically fly at a faster airspeed in order to takeoff or land at KGL. Combined with a high temperature, this could make KGL a "Hot & High" airport, where the air density is lower than it would otherwise be at sea level.
  • In 2004, the airport served 135,189 passengers.

Facts about Bourg - Ceyzériat Airport (XBK):

  • It is walking distance from Bourg-en-Bresse Jasseron motorway station which offers a restaurant and hotel.
  • In addition to being known as "Bourg - Ceyzériat Airport", another name for XBK is "Aéroport de Bourg - Ceyzériat".
  • The closest airport to Bourg - Ceyzériat Airport (XBK) is Lyon–Saint Exupéry Airport (LYS), which is located 35 miles (56 kilometers) SSW of XBK.
  • The furthest airport from Bourg - Ceyzériat Airport (XBK) is Chatham Islands (CHT), which is nearly antipodal to Bourg - Ceyzériat Airport (meaning Bourg - Ceyzériat Airport is almost on the exact opposite side of the Earth from Chatham Islands), and is located 12,251 miles (19,715 kilometers) away in Waitangi, Chatham Islands, New Zealand.
  • Bourg - Ceyzériat Airport (XBK) has 2 runways.
  • Because of Bourg - Ceyzériat Airport's relatively low elevation of 857 feet, planes can take off or land at Bourg - Ceyzériat Airport at a lower air speed than at airports located at a higher elevation. This is because the air density is higher closer to sea level than it would otherwise be at higher elevations.
